Tips for Creating Famous Funny Looking Cartoon Characters

Crafting memorable and humorous cartoon characters that resonate with audiences requires careful consideration and execution. Here are some practical tips to enhance your character development process:

Tip 1: Emphasize Exaggerated Features:

Funny looking cartoon characters often possess exaggerated physical attributes, such as large eyes, disproportionate limbs, and distinctive facial expressions. These exaggerated features create a comical appearance that instantly captures attention and adds to the character's humorous persona.

Tip 2: Develop Quirky Personalities:

Beyond physical appearance, imbue your characters with unique and quirky personalities. Consider their motivations, fears, and aspirations. Develop character traits that contrast or complement each other, creating a dynamic and memorable cast.

Tip 3: Create Humorous Behaviors:

Funny looking cartoon characters are known for their humorous behaviors and antics. Craft actions and reactions that are unexpected, exaggerated, or defy logical expectations. These behaviors will elicit laughter and make your characters stand out.

Tip 4: Utilize Visual Appeal:

The visual design of your characters plays a crucial role in their comedic impact. Experiment with vibrant colors, unique shapes, and exaggerated expressions to create visually appealing characters that captivate audiences through their appearance alone.

Tip 5: Ensure Relatability:

Despite their exaggerated features and humorous nature, famous funny looking cartoon characters often resonate with audiences due to their relatable qualities. Infuse your characters with human-like emotions, vulnerabilities, and aspirations to create a connection with viewers.

Tip 6: Consider Cultural Impact:

Understanding the cultural context of your audience can enhance the humor and relatability of your characters. Research cultural norms, humor styles, and social trends to create characters that resonate with a specific target audience.

Tip 7: Seek Feedback and Iterate:

Character development is an iterative process. Seek feedback from trusted sources, such as colleagues, industry professionals, or test audiences. Gather insights and make necessary adjustments to refine your characters and maximize their comedic potential.

Tip 8: Practice and Experiment:

Creating funny looking cartoon characters requires practice and experimentation. Sketch, animate, and develop various character concepts to explore different possibilities. The more you practice, the more proficient you will become in crafting memorable and humorous characters.
